This invitation set is elegant and timeless yet still feels fresh and contemporary. This modern black tie wedding invitation is a custom design courtesy of our friends at Big City Bride.
Black letterpress on our luxurious 2-ply cotton paper is classic and sets the tone for this black tie affair. Chamagne matte foil edging introduces a touch of glamor. The invitation is finished with a silk ribbon hand-tied in a bow. The envelope liner features our Underwood pattern digitally printed in Spruce, which beautifully coordinates with our spruce envelope. We were thrilled to see a feature in Chicago Social on Johnna and Sam’s beautiful modern wedding, brimming with personal touches, including several appearances by their mini dachshund, and lots of Chicago flair. Johnna is our friend from Big City Bride, and we previously highlighted her and Sam’s custom-designed save the date.
The wedding colors were bright pink, orange, and yellow, and each printed piece featured a single one of these colors. The modern invitation boasts a flood of bright pink letterpress, with the text created by the areas without printing.

The rehearsal dinner invitation features the same flood of color, with the reverse creating the text and border, except this time the ink color is papaya. All the pieces in the suite featured the same design, but in different colors. The cards were square, with the invitation being the largest, and each subsequent card sized down. Before being placed in the envelope, the cards were stacked in size order, with the largest on the bottom and the smallest on top, and secured with metallic gold thread. This presentation created a collective ombre look, since the bold colors of each card peeked out around the edges of the smaller cards stacked on top.
